Vai al contenuto principale Passa a contenuto complementare

Autorizzazioni richieste

In questa sezione si descrivono le autorizzazioni specificate dall'utente nelle impostazioni di connettore che devono essere concesse nel database di origine.

Esecuzione con il ruolo db_owner su istanza gestita di Azure SQL.

Nota informaticaQueste autorizzazioni sono rilevanti solo per le istanze gestite di Azure SQL. Quando si esegue il ruolo db_owner su Azure SQL Database, non sono necessarie altre autorizzazioni.

Se l'utente è un membro del ruolo db_owner per il database, devono essere concesse le seguenti autorizzazioni:

  • Sul database principale:

    • concedere VIEW ANY DEFINITION (Può visualizzare qualsiasi definizione)
    • concedere VIEW SERVER STATE (può visualizzare lo stato del server)
  • Sul database MSDB:

    • concedere SELECT ON SYSJOBACTIVITY (può selezionare su SYSJOBACTIVITY)

    • concedere SELECT ON SYSJOBS (può selezionare su SYSJOBS)

Esecuzione senza il ruolo di db_owner

Se l'utente non è un membro del ruolo del database db_owner, devono essere concesse le seguenti autorizzazioni al database di origine:

  • concedere VIEW DATABASE STATE (può visualizzare lo stato del database)
  • concedere SELECT (può selezionare)
Nota informaticaIn caso di esecuzione senza il ruolo db_owner, MS-CDC non può essere abilitato automaticamente e deve quindi essere abilitato manualmente. Per evitare errori in spostamento, è necessario deselezionare la casella di controllo Abilita MS-CDC su tutte le tabelle acquisite nelle proprietà di connessione prima di eseguire l'attività. Per ulteriori informazioni, vedi Microsoft SQL Server (basato su Microsoft CDC)

Hai trovato utile questa pagina?

Se riscontri problemi con questa pagina o con il suo contenuto – un errore di battitura, un passaggio mancante o un errore tecnico – facci sapere come possiamo migliorare!